Gaming consoles have come a long way since their inception, transforming from simple 8-bit machines to powerful 8K systems. This journey through the evolution of gaming consoles highlights how technology has shaped the gaming experience over the decades.
The Dawn of Gaming: 8-Bit Era
In the early 1980s, gaming consoles were rudimentary compared to today's standards. The 8-bit era, marked by systems like the Nintendo Entertainment System (NES) and Sega Master System, laid the foundation for modern gaming. These consoles featured pixelated graphics and simple sound effects but captured the imagination of gamers with classic titles like Super Mario Bros. and Sonic the Hedgehog.
The simplicity of the 8-bit era allowed for creativity in game design, with developers pushing the limits of the hardware to create engaging and memorable experiences. Despite the technical limitations, these games often became iconic, and the consoles themselves are still celebrated by enthusiasts and collectors today.
The 16-Bit Revolution
The 16-bit era, represented by the Super Nintendo Entertainment System (SNES) and Sega Genesis, brought significant improvements in graphics and sound. This generation introduced vibrant, detailed visuals and more complex gameplay mechanics. Titles such as The Legend of Zelda: A Link to the Past and Streets of Rage showcased the enhanced capabilities of these systems.
The 16-bit consoles marked a shift towards more immersive and engaging experiences, with developers exploring new genres and storytelling techniques. This era laid the groundwork for the next major leap in gaming technology.
The 32/64-Bit Era: A New Dimension
The late 1990s saw the advent of the 32-bit and 64-bit consoles, which further revolutionized the gaming industry. Sony's PlayStation and Nintendo 64, along with Sega's Saturn, introduced 3D graphics, allowing for more dynamic and expansive game worlds. Games like Final Fantasy VII and The Legend of Zelda: Ocarina of Time set new standards for visual fidelity and gameplay depth.
This era also saw the rise of CD-ROMs as a medium, replacing cartridges and offering greater storage capacity for games. The transition to 3D graphics marked a significant leap in the realism and complexity of video games, paving the way for future innovations.
The HD Era: High Definition Gaming
The 2000s ushered in the HD era, with consoles such as the PlayStation 3, Xbox 360, and Nintendo Wii. These systems introduced high-definition graphics, providing a clearer and more detailed visual experience. Games like Halo 3 and The Elder Scrolls V: Skyrim showcased the potential of HD graphics and advanced gameplay mechanics.
The HD era also saw the rise of online gaming, with services like Xbox Live and PlayStation Network allowing players to connect and compete with others around the world. This generation of consoles marked a significant shift towards more interactive and connected gaming experiences.
The 4K Era: Ultra High Definition
The 2010s brought about the 4K era, with the release of the PlayStation 4 Pro, Xbox One X, and the Nintendo Switch. These consoles supported ultra-high-definition graphics, providing stunning visual clarity and more immersive experiences. Games such as Red Dead Redemption II and The Last of Us Part II took full advantage of the 4K capabilities, offering breathtaking graphics and detailed environments.
The 4K era also saw advancements in virtual reality (VR) and augmented reality (AR), with platforms like PlayStation VR and various AR applications enhancing the way gamers interact with virtual worlds. This generation marked a new level of immersion and realism in gaming.
The 8K Era: The Future of Gaming
As we move into the 2020s, the 8K era is beginning to take shape. Consoles like the PlayStation 5 and Xbox Series X support 8K resolution, promising even greater visual fidelity and detail. While native 8K content is still emerging, these systems are paving the way for future advancements in gaming technology.
The 8K era also emphasizes faster load times, improved frame rates, and enhanced ray tracing capabilities, further pushing the boundaries of what is possible in gaming. As technology continues to evolve, we can expect even more impressive advancements in graphics, performance, and interactivity.
